Description

Pink flowers held above silver foliage.

This shrubby variety slowly creeps out to fill areas as large a 1.5m if given the time. Good structure through winter holding on to seed heads. Stems of Pink flowers held above foliage start early summer and continue through to late summer. Works in the driest of soils once established and will also work in general borders, alpine rock gardens, walls and containers.

Flowering: Summer

Hardiness: Hardy

Height: 15-25cm

Spread: 40cm+

 

 

Common Name: Spiny germander

Life Cycle: Perennial

Family:  Lamiaceae

Foliage:  obovate / crenate

Basic Colour: ( pink )

Flower Colour: pink

Natural Flowering:  May – August

Winter Hardiness: Fully Hardy

Height with Flowers: 20-35cm

Soil Requirements:  well-drained / average / moist

Soil ph:  alkaline / neutral

Location:  border / cottage garden / rock garden / container / Mediterranean

Usage:  ornamental

Pruning: cut back old flowered stems

Tolerates: drought tolerant / deer resistance / rabbit resistance / salt tolerant

Origin: Europe
